In this month’s legal updates, Sophie Brookes of Gately Legal considers whether a company’s accountants owed a duty of care to a shareholder, company restoration and CIGA 2020
Case: do accountants owe duty of care to shareholder?
The High Court has found that accountants retained by a company to advise on a demerger were not liable to a shareholder of the company in connection with that demerger.
The facts
Carmela de Sena & Meltor Developments Ltd v Joseph Notaro & ors [2020] EWHC 1031 (Ch) involved a family company, S Notaro Holdings Limited (Notaro) of which a brother and sister were directors and principal shareholders.
